7. In Missouri in
2000 the most common form of custody awarded to divorcing parents
was joint custody.
Yes, this statement is false. In
about 25% of divorces in Missouri in 2000 joint legal custody was
granted. The most common custody arrangement was for mothers to be
awarded sole custody-about 63% and fathers were awarded custody in
10% of the cases. There are a few cases (2%) in which grandparents
or other relatives obtain custody. In Missouri parents are required
to develop a parenting plan to help them work about the care of
their children.
